Problem
Existing generative AI models, both weak and strong, suffer from inaccuracies such as hallucinations and require significant computational resources, leading to a trade-off between accuracy and efficiency.
Innovation Solution
A model distillation system that uses concept distillation to transfer rich features from strong generative models to weak generative models, improving accuracy without retraining, thereby enhancing efficiency and flexibility.

AI summary
This disclosure describes a model distillation system that implements a framework for improving and enhancing the reliability of weak generative models. For example, the model distillation system uses concept distillation for prompt construction to improve the accuracy of weak generative models while maintaining their efficiency advantage over strong generative models. In particular, the model distillation system determines and transfers implicit rich features of a strong generative model to a weak generative model for specific topics and concepts. By using these rich features, the weak generative model can correctly answer queries and prompts for the specific topics and concepts that it would otherwise answer incorrectly. Furthermore, the model distillation system transfers these rich features without needing fine-tuning or retraining, resulting in improved accuracy while still maintaining high levels of efficiency.
